    I wanted to know, is it possible, to allow uploading images to galleries, but not to create them?

    I have a few users in the Subscriber role and I want them to upload images to my 3 galleries (I created them as admin). I configured NextGEN to allow subscribers to upload images, but they can also create galleries and I want to disable it. Is it possible in any way?

  • I’m unsure of how to do this, but I wanted this exact thing.

    What I did, instead, was went into the nextgen gallery folder and edited the file ‘nggallery.php’ and simply deleted the lines of code that pertained to creating galleries.

    Then, to create my own galleries, I simply did it manually via FTP.

    Not the greatest way, but it works if you’re the only one that creates the gallery folders.
